The original Cinderella story imparts several moral lessons. It teaches that perseverance pays off. Cinderella endured years of mistreatment but never gave up hope. Also, it emphasizes the importance of kindness. Cinderella's kindness towards others, including animals, was noticed by the fairy godmother. And finally, it shows that true love can find a way, as the prince was able to find Cinderella despite the odds.

The moral lesson is one of acceptance and change. Zacchaeus was short and had to take extreme measures to see Jesus. Jesus' acceptance of Zacchaeus despite his being a tax collector was a powerful statement. It teaches us that people can be redeemed. Zacchaeus' subsequent actions of restitution - giving to the poor and making amends for his wrongdoings - are evidence of the positive change that can occur when one is touched by a greater power or principle. It encourages us not to write off people based on their past actions or occupations.
